Warning Signs You Need Restaurant Water Damage Restoration

Don’t ignore the warning signs of water damage in your restaurant.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Our team is here to help you identify the warning signs and take immediate action.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can show hidden moisture damage in your restaurant. This can be due to a leaky pipe, overflowing drain, or other issue. Don’t wait to address the problem, contact our team today.

Warped or Buckled Floors

Warped or buckled floors can be a sign of water damage, especially if they’re located near a water source. Our team will assess the damage and develop a plan to restore your floors to their original condition.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age, even if it’s not immediately apparent. Our team will inspect the area and recommend the necessary repairs to prevent further damage.

Stains or Discoloration

Unexplained stains or discoloration on walls, ceilings, or floors can show water damage. Our team will assess the damage and develop a plan to restore your property to its original condition.

Water Stains on Ceilings

Water stains on ceilings can be a sign of a leaky roof, clogged gutters, or other issue. Don’t wait to address the problem, contact our team today.

Restaurant Water Damage Restoration Cost in Chapel Hill, TN

The cost of water damage restoration in Chapel Hill, TN, will depend on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will assess the damage and provide you with a detailed estimate for the necessary repairs. We’ll work with your insurance company to help with a smooth claims process and ensure that you’re not left with any unexpected expenses.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of water present will impact the cost of this service.
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$100 – $500 The type and amount of equipment needed to sanitize and disinfect the affected area will impact the cost of this service.
Final Cleanup and Restoration $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area, the type of repairs needed, and local labor costs will impact the cost of this service.
